The incident happened at Mi Rinconcito Ecuatoriano in Newark, New Jersey. According to New Jersey News 12, the suspect walked into the restaurant on South Street back on February 20th and used Google Translate to inform employees that he was robbing them. Reports say he then tried to steal the cash register before running out.

Maria, the owner of the restaurant, tells New Jersey News 12, "A man came to buy a coffee, and he bought a coffee and then he wanted to keep the money. And when [the cashier] told him to take it, he didn't take it and got angry, he threw the coffee at her and then he thew a case that was on the table at her."
